Globes: Shekel weakening against resurgent euro
Published on Sep 12 2012 // Business and Financial News, Market
12 September 12 11:05–The shekel is continuing to strengthen against the dollar, but is weakening against the euro in morning inter-bank trading today. The shekel-dollar exchange rate fell 0.26%, compared with yesterday’s representative rate, to NIS 3.951/$, and the shekel-euro exchange rate rose 0.35% to NIS 5.085/€.
In international markets, the euro hit a fourth-month high against the dollar, trading at $1.2885/$.
